#832f63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#832f63 is composed of 51.4% red, 18.4%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 34.9%. #832f63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ec6 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#832f63 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#832f63 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#832f63 has RGB values of R:131, G:47,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.24,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8597347.

Shades and Tints of #832f63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f2f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#832f63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5859 is the less saturated color, while #ac066d is the most saturated one.
